Comprehending Low-VOC Paints
When you choose low-VOC paints, you're selecting an item that emits less unstable organic substances, which can be hazardous to both your health and wellness and the environment.
VOCs are chemicals located in numerous paint items that can vaporize into the air and contribute to indoor air contamination. By choosing low-VOC choices, you're decreasing the number of these emissions, making your home much safer.
Low-VOC paints commonly consist of 50 grams per liter or fewer VOCs, compared to typical paints that can contain approximately 250 grams per liter. This indicates that when you paint your home with low-VOC items, you're not just making a choice for aesthetics; you're likewise taking a step towards a much healthier indoor atmosphere.
These paints come in a range of surfaces and colors, so you will not need to endanger on design. They're suitable for both exterior and interior projects, supplying durability and protection like their conventional counterparts.
Plus, many suppliers are now concentrating on developing low-VOC formulas without compromising efficiency. Understanding low-VOC paints equips you to make educated selections for your home and health while adding to environmental conservation.

Potential Downsides to Think About
While low-VOC paints offer many benefits, there are some prospective downsides to bear in mind. One substantial issue is their efficiency contrasted to conventional paints. Low-VOC choices might not constantly supply the same degree of longevity and insurance coverage, which can bring about more frequent touch-ups or a need for extra layers. This can be aggravating and taxing during your paint job.
An additional issue is the drying time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can expand your project timeline. If you're on a limited routine, this could be a downside to think about.
You ought to additionally be aware that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a various finish or texture. If you're aiming for a specific visual, see to it to evaluate samples to make sure the result meets your assumptions.
Lastly, while low-VOC paints are generally much safer, they can still send out some fumes. Correct ventilation is vital throughout and after application, so be prepared to air out your space efficiently.
